Common Mistakes to Avoid
When sending course announcement emails, avoid these common pitfalls: Overloading with Information: Keep the email concise and to the point.
Weak Subject Lines: Avoid generic or bland subject lines that fail to capture interest.
No Clear CTA: Ensure your call to action is prominent and easy to follow.
Ignoring Feedback: Pay attention to feedback and adjust your strategy accordingly.
Not Testing: Failing to test different elements can result in missed opportunities for improvement.
